Sept. 20: Southern Illinois The Salukis shut out Taylor in their season opener, 45-0, behind the legs of Malcolm Agnew. The se- nior running back, a transfer from Oregon State, rushed for 145 yards and caught a 62-yard scoring pass despite playing just a half. The win bumped Southern Illinois into the FCS rankings (No. 25) for the first time since 2011. The Salukis head into this week's matchup with ranked East- ern Illinois trying to start the sea- son 2-0 for the first time since 2007. Sept. 27: Iowa The Hawkeyes struggled to beat Northern Iowa 31-23 in a game in which Iowa was only up one halfway through the fourth quarter. Junior quarterback Jake Ru- dock threw for 250 yards and two scores. Running back Mark Weis- man, who almost eclipsed 1,000 yards on the ground in 2013, only managed to gain 34 yards on 10 carries against the Panthers. This week, Iowa entertains Ball State.
